Eric Close - Age, Family, Bio

Television veteran who played the role of Martin Fitzgerald on Without a Trace from 2002 to 2009 and landed a role in ABC's Nashville. Before Fame He graduated from the University of Southern California in 1989 with a BA in Communications. Trivia He had recurring roles on the series, Nashville, Dark Skies and Sisters. Family Life He married Keri Close in 1995 and the couple have two daughters, Katie and Ella. Associated With He acted alongside Gabriel Macht in three episodes of Suits in 2012. [Read More]

Janet Jackson, Rolling Stone - Top 10 Nude Magazine Covers: From Kim Kardashian to Lennon

The year 1993 was when a 24-year-old Janet Jackson came of age. After signing a contract worth nearly $50 million with Virgin Records, Jackson debuted on her new label the sexually charged album janet. It was chock-full of racy lyrics, but the carnality didn't stop there. For janet's cover, photographer Patrick Demarchelier snapped shots of the pop star shirtless, her chest covered only by then boyfriend Rene Elizondo's hands. According to the Los Angeles Times, Jackson offered photos from the session to Rolling Stone for its September 1993 cover story on the pop star. [Read More]

Leicester City Confirm Nature, Length Of Wilfred Ndidi's Injury

Leicester City manager, Enzo Maresca has confirmed that Nigerian defensive midfielder Wilfred Ndidi will be sidelined for at least three months. Recall that Ndidi was included in the Super Eagles of Nigeria’s 25-man squad for the 2023 Africa Cup of Nations which will commence in Ivory Coast on January 13. But he had to be replaced when it was confirmed that he had been injured. However, earlier today, January 3, Super Eagles official Instagram page confirmed that the coach has replaced Wilfred Ndidi with Alhassan Yusuf even though the nature of Ndidi’s injury had not been confirmed. London School of Economic denies Melaye attended institution

- Senator Dino Melaye is in a web of scandal over his academic qualification - The Senator claimed he graduated from several universities - The LSE said there was no record of his name in the school Senator Dino Melaye’s current scandal concerning his academic qualification took another wrong turn after the London School of Economics and Political Science (LSE) denied that he got a degree from the institution. The senator from Kogi has been accused of not graduating from the Ahmadu Bello University where he studied geography although he has insisted that he did while also claiming that he has several degrees from various universities in Nigeria and abroad.
